What does the Zelle emoji mean?
The ultimate symbol for sending or requesting money in the chat.
This emoji features the official logo of Zelle, the popular peer-to-peer payment service. It is frequently used in Discord servers to signal financial transactions, request payment for services, or jokingly demand money from friends.
When to use it
- Requesting payment for a shared server expense
- Confirming that a digital transaction was sent
- Jokingly asking friends for some quick cash
- Promoting a commission or digital service sale

How to add this emoji
Add to Discord
- Click Download PNG above to save the Zelle image.
- Open Discord and go to Server Settings → Emoji.
- Click Upload Emoji and choose the downloaded file.
- Give it a name and save. You need the Manage Emojis and Stickers permission.
